Precision trim carpentry


PRECISION TRIM CARPENTRY
By Rick Williams
Step by step color photos for these 20 projects some how make the tricky corners of carpentry seem utterly simple. Projects include a variety of doors and door casings painted or stained wainscot paneling, built in cabinets, shelves and parquet flooring. Author reveals secret of how to line u the corners of skirting boards so that there is no gap at the inter section and the same technique is applied to ceiling moldings. Installing an interior door can be a fiddly business but the author shows how to use a plumb line and spacer blocks for a perfect fit. The surface of the pre finished parquet flooring usually holds up well and the photos are invaluable for reassuring a DIY enthusiast that the floor really is supposed to look like that half way through. After the carpentry projects, a final home improvement focuses on the walls, introducing the technique of bag painting or rag rolling in UK parlance. A guide to wood working terms, adhesives, stains and top coats concludes.
